When selecting the right embossing machine for your business, several key features must be considered. The embossing speed is crucial. A machine that can emboss quickly can improve productivity. Reports suggest that businesses with higher output often see a 20% increase in production efficiency. The type of materials compatible with the machine is also essential. Choose a machine capable of handling various substrates, including paper, plastic, and leather. This versatility ensures your business can satisfy diverse customer needs.
Another important factor is the machine's size and weight. Compact machines may be more suitable for smaller workspaces. However, larger machines may handle bigger jobs more efficiently. According to industry insights, around 40% of businesses reflected on the limited space issue affecting their operational capacity. Additionally, consider the ease of use and maintenance. A user-friendly interface can significantly reduce training time for staff, leading to smoother operations. Regular maintenance is vital to ensure longevity, as neglected machines can average a 30% decline in performance over time.
Lastly, warranty and support services should not be overlooked. A solid warranty indicates the manufacturer's confidence in their product. Businesses often report higher satisfaction when they have access to prompt support. Maintaining your embossing machine is essential for its longevity and efficiency. Regular cleaning is a fundamental step. Dust and debris can accumulate in delicate areas, causing jams or malfunctions. Use a soft cloth to wipe down the exterior, and check for any build-up around moving parts. This small action can prevent bigger issues down the line.
Check the machine's settings frequently. An incorrect adjustment can lead to uneven embossing results. Regularly inspect the pressure and temperature settings. This helps in achieving consistent quality. Remember to lubricate moving parts according to the manufacturer's guidelines. This reduces friction and minimizes wear over time.
Occasionally, a problem may arise. It’s crucial to address these issues promptly. Waiting too long could exacerbate the problem. Document any mechanical failures and their solutions. This will serve as a useful reference for future maintenance. Keep the machine's manual close at hand; it's a valuable resource. Regularly review it to familiarize yourself with maintenance protocols. This knowledge can aid in troubleshooting effectively and ensure your embossing machine serves you well.
